MEMO — Kettling Depot Receiving

Uniform sets for the new Kettling depot arrive Wednesday via Ashgrove courier: 40 boxes, sorted by size, manifest attached to box one. Check the count at the dock before signing; shortages go straight to stores, not the courier. The hand-over instruction the courier will follow is set out below.

drop instructions, tafof-baguf: the holmir gilox courier leaves the sormir ulaok holdor ledger at gate 5596 under passcode 257343

### SDK Parity: Brindle-JS vs Brindle-Go

Both SDKs target the Lanternworks internal API and must stay feature-identical. Any endpoint added to Brindle-Go requires a matching Brindle-JS release in the same sprint; the parity checker in CI blocks merges otherwise. Pagination, retry semantics, and error codes are shared via the common spec file. Parity tests run against the staging gateway and authenticate with the internal key below.

API key for fahip-kahip: zpat23_XiJGUHz5xfaAtaIqUkus0rh

Handover: Pinefeather firmware channel is stable. One rollout (v4.2.1) paused at 40% after elevated reboot reports; leave it paused until QA signs off. Canary cohort looks clean. Don't promote anything to the broad channel without two approvals. Runbook is in the fleet wiki. Questions about the pause go here.

alerts address for kajog-tadup: druox@plorvanet.internal